Remote is solving modern organizationsโ€™ biggest challenge โ€“ navigating global employment compliantly with ease. We make it possible for businesses of all sizes to recruit, pay, and manage international teams. With our core values at heart and future focused work culture, our team works tirelessly on ambitious problems, asynchronously, around the world. You can find Remoters working from 6 different continents (Antarctica left to go!) and all of our positions are fully remote.We encourage every member of the Remote team to bring their talents, experiences and culture to the table to help us build the best-in-class HR platform.

If you are energetic, curious, motivated and ambitious, be part of our world. Apply now and define the future of work!

The position

You'll be joining a team of engineers across Frontend, Backend, SRE and QA. We're organised into cross-functional development teams assigned to specific verticals.

This role is open for several teams, and we will define the exact team that you will be joining during the interview process based on the business needs and your preferences.

Regardless of the specific team, you will be working on building tools, APIs and integrations for one of our products.

Our backend is built with Elixir and Phoenix, with a Postgres database. We use React and Next.js for our front-end. GitLab is used as a version control tool and a CI/CD solution. Our applications are hosted on AWS. We fully rely on our CI for deployments and deploy multiple times per day. You can check out our Engineering Rulebook to learn more.

We are looking for a Head of IT Monitoring Team to lead two teamsโ€”24/7 Duty Admins (L1) and Technical Monitoring Specialistsโ€”and to design, develop, implement, and operate a comprehensive monitoring service that ensures stability, performance, and security of our IT infrastructure and products.

Your main tasks will be:

  • Provide strategic leadership, set team goals aligned with company objectives, and own the roadmap for advancing monitoring capabilities.
  • Build, operate, and evolve the monitoring stack (Zabbix, Grafana, Prometheus and others) with strong support for microservices and cloud monitoring (AWS CloudWatch / Azure Monitor / Google Cloud Monitoring).
  • Ensure timely detection and resolution of alerts, increasing the share of incidents resolved by the L1 duty team without escalation; establish procedures based on ITIL and manage SLAs.
  • Collaborate with IT/product teams to smoothly transition new monitoring solutions into production, and maintain clear operational documentation and runbooks.
  • Develop people: upskill teammates, define a transparent career ladder, and prepare regular reports with operational metrics and team results.

We expect from you:

  • Proven leadership running monitoring/observability teams in companies with high-loaded web systems.
  • Strong knowledge of monitoring protocols, tools (Zabbix, Grafana, Prometheus), methodologies, and best practices; proficiency in monitoring microservices.
  • Hands-on experience with RCA practices for critical events and with cloud monitoring (CloudWatch, Azure Monitor, Google Cloud Monitoring).
  • Excellent communication skills and responsibility; experience building teams, developing people, and giving regular feedback; English B2+.
  • Nice to have: ITIL Foundation certification; familiarity with AIOps and AI-driven monitoring; full-stack development experience to build internal tools, integrations, and dashboards.

We are looking for a Network Engineer.

Your Key Responsibilities

Network Implementation:

  • Perform greenfield and brownfield network deployments.
  • Configure and install a variety of network devices and services.
  • Configure and support network monitoring tools (Zabbix, Grafana, PRTG).

Network Maintenance:

  • Perform regular network monitoring to ensure optimal performance.
  • Handle and resolve incidents within defined SLAs.
  • Open and manage service requests with vendors and service providers.
  • Maintain up-to-date network inventory.
  • Automate routine operations to improve efficiency.

Troubleshooting & Issue Resolution:

  • Diagnose and resolve network-related issues promptly to minimize downtime.
  • Conduct root cause analysis and implement corrective actions for recurring problems.
  • Provide on-call support for critical network emergencies.

Collaboration & Stakeholder Management:

  • Work closely with system administrators, security teams, and other IT staff to ensure seamless integration of systems and network components.
  • Engage with vendors to evaluate new products, technologies, and solutions aligned with business needs.

On-call Support:

  • Respond within 15 minutes to on-call alerts, assess the situation, and take necessary steps to minimize business impact.

What We Expect From You

  • Experience: 5+ years as a Network Engineer.
  • Certifications: CCNP, JNCIP, or equivalent level of expertise.
  • Strong knowledge of routing protocols, data center networking, and network architecture.

Hard Skills:

  • Cisco Equipment: Hands-on experience with Catalyst, Nexus, and Firepower series.
  • Networking Protocols: VXLAN EVPN, Firepower/ASA, BGP, OSPF, MSTP/RSTP, GRE, L2TP, IPSEC, LACP, vPC.
  • Operating Systems: Networking in Linux, Hyper-V, VMware environments.
  • Automation: Python, Ansible (network process automation).
  • Cloud Networking: AWS, Azure, GCP integration with on-prem networks.
  • Monitoring: Zabbix (templates, maps, triggers), Grafana, PRTG, NetBox.
  • Troubleshooting Tools: iPerf, tcpdump, Wireshark, mtr, traceroute, nmap.
